When to prune succulentsSucculent plants do not need to be pruned, but pruning is still necessary to allow them to reproduce again, and it is generally appropriate to prune in spring. How to prune the branches and leaves of succulent plantsWhen pruning succulents, you must first determine the plant shape, then remove dead and diseased branches, cut off overlapping branches, crossed branches, and unnecessary branches, and pinch off the top to encourage it to branch more and grow better. Pruning makes growth fast: If succulents have dead leaves or diseased leaves, they should be cleaned up in time, and old leaves should be pulled out regularly. If dead leaves appear at the bottom, do not leave them on the branches for too long, otherwise pests will easily breed.
